Finance Review — Regional Sales Snapshot

Quick one for department heads: Drennick region beat plan on the Maravel line, while Southgate lagged on renewals. Discount creep is the main culprit, so expect tighter approval rules next month. Full deck lands Friday. One sensitive planning item needs your attention, and it's noted directly below.

internal memo for yajef-tajeg: The renewal with Ralaelek Group closes at $2 million a year, 15 percent above the last contract. Project Zorix slips by two quarters because of the tooling delay.

## Further reading: the Thornquist planner regression

Plugin authors targeting Fennelway 4.2 should understand the planner regression that shipped in 4.1.3, where cardinality estimates for correlated subqueries degraded badly. Your cost hints may need recalibration, and the workaround flags are documented with examples. Before filing issues against the planner, please read the detailed regression analysis, which we keep current on this internal page.

runbook for badug-kadup: https://confluence.zemvarlabs.internal/projects/browse/display/projects/bd1b

Subject: Contrast audit cut-over complete

Hi support team,

The Lumenscale color-contrast audit service finished cut-over last night. All customer themes are now checked against the stricter ruleset, so you may see new warnings in the theme editor — these are expected, not regressions. Please direct escalations through the usual triage queue. For reference when troubleshooting, the live audit service now runs with these settings.

config for kagup-hahig:
druwyn:
  pin: 2801
  metrics_host: metrics.druwyn.zemvarlabs.internal
  tenant: sorius
  seal: seal_798a43d7